In addition to the Graph feature for each document type, in Documents on the Default ribbon, you may also print Graphs per week or Graphs per month for posted document types on the User reports menu:

  1. Graphs Graphs per week Sales menu:  
    1. Sales (Invoices - Credit notes) per week 
    2. Invoices per week 
    3. Credit notes per week 
    4. Quotes per week 
  2. Graphs Graphs per week Purchases menu:  
    1. Purchases (Purchases - Supplier returns) per week 
    2. Purchases per week 
    3. Supplier returns per week 
    4. Orders per week 
  3. Graphs Graphs per month Sales menu:  
    1. Sales (Invoices - Credit notes) per month 
    2. Invoices per month  
    3. Credit notes per month  
    4. Quotes per month 
  4. Graphs Graphs per month Purchases menu:  
    1. Purchases (Purchase - Supplier returns) per month  
    2. Purchases per month  
    3. Supplier returns per month  
    4. Orders per month  

View graphs

You may filter and view the documents in a graph.

To view the documents in graph, you may use the following options for the data to be included in the graph:

  • Document types - Select the document type (i.e. invoices, credit notes, quotes purchases, supplier returns or orders). 
  • Document status - Select All, Posted or Unposted and Confirmed (Quotes and Orders). 
  • Filter options to select the documents to include or exclude from the graph , etc. 

To view the documents in a graph, click on the Graph button.

To close the graph, click on the Graph button again.

Customize Chart

Customize Chart : Types

The default chart diagram is the “Column diagram”. You may select the one of the following diagrams to view the graph. 


Customize Chart : Series

By default, only the Amount inclusive and Due amount and Tax amount is displayed. 

You may remove the tick of the series or add a tick to a series. For example, if you wish to see the amount exclusive, tick that option and if you do not wish to view the tax amount, remove the tick.

Sort by: select the options in the series to change the sequence of the documents in the graph is displayed.

Customize Chart : Data Groups 

The Data Groups will list all the columns headings (field names) of the Document selection screen.

Customize Chart : Options 

You may change the default values for the “Legend, Title, Toolbox” and “Other (Value Hints)“ according to your requirements.  

 

Customize Chart : Data groups 

The data groups list all the available columns on the Documents grid, which is not already set as "Data Levels".  You may add or remove any of the available Data Groups on the "Data Levels".

To add a "Data Group" to the "Data Levels":

  1. Click on the Customize Chart button.
  2. On the "Customisation" screen, click on the Data Groups tab.
  3. Select the available data group form the list you wish to add to the "Data Levels".
  4. Drag and drop the data group to the required place on the "Data Levels".  


To remove a "Data Group" from the "Data Levels":

  1. Click on the Customize Chart button.
  2. On the "Customisation" screen, click on the Data Groups tab.
  3. Select the available data group on the "Data Levels".  
  4. Drag the data group to any place below the "Data Levels". When the mouse pointer change to a big X, drop it. The data field will be added to its original place on the list in the "Data Groups" tab of the "Customisation" screen.
